Texas Governor Greg Abbott has announced a plan aimed at lowering health insurance costs for families and expanding coverage across the state. The initiative promises an average reduction of over $1,000 in annual health insurance premiums for typical families. Details of the plan focus on measures to increase market competition and provide more affordable options. Abbott’s strategy also seeks to broaden insurance access for small businesses, potentially unlocking coverage for more Texans. The governor’s office stated this will alleviate financial burdens on Texas households. Further information regarding specific policy changes and implementation timelines will be released soon, as the plan moves forward. This move aims to address a significant concern for many Texans struggling with rising healthcare expenses.
